You will still need:
State-issued Birth Certificate (NOT Hospital Certificate)
□ Proof of Residency (e.g. Deed, Rental Agreement, Water, Electric or Gas Bill)
□ Registration Form
□ McKinney-Vento Homeless Assistance Act Form (MVA)
□ Migrant Form
□ Court (Custody) Papers {if applicable}
□ Health Information Questionnaire
□F14 Card (Student Health Record) (Original Cardstock may be obtained from the office)
□ TB Clearance (from Physician or Department of Health)
*Department of Health (DOH), Lihue Office provides FREE TB Clearance on Mondays 1-4PM
(call DOH to confirm time and schedule) or see your Physician
□ Physical Exam (PE) within 1 year of entry date to a Hawaii School
Must be signed by a US License MD, DO, APRN, PA
□ All Required Immunizations
Must be signed by a US License MD, DO, APRN, PA
*Religious Exemption Form Epi7A available from Health Room
Students must attend the school that serves the geographic area where they reside. However, permission
to attend another school may be granted by the Department of Education. Please use FORM CHP13-1 and
submit to your geographic area home school. Visit hawaiipublicschools.org for more information on
Geographic Exceptions.
The child must be 5 years old on or before July 31 to be eligible to attend DOE kindergarten. DOE will not accept a child who is not 5 on or before July 31.
